Governor Extends Emergency Order To July 4
Governor Eric J. Holcomb last week signed Executive Order 20-30 to extend the public health emergency for an additional 30 days to July 4.
The Governor also signed Executive Order 20-31 which allows older youth to remain in foster care beyond the age of 18 for the duration of the public health emergency. This will allow them to continue to receive education, workforce training and health benefits.
